Macron-Scholz Clash on Ukraine Troop Deployment Strains EU-NATO Unity
February 28, 2024
French President Macron faces opposition from German Chancellor Scholz on the idea of deploying Western troops to Ukraine.
Chancellor Scholz has firmly rejected any such military proposal, causing tensions between France and Germany.
The discord over military support reveals deeper rifts within the European alliance and NATO at a particularly sensitive time.
Ukraine's President Zelensky backs the deployment proposal and is set to discuss it with Macron in an upcoming mid-March meeting.
Beyond troop deployment, disagreements also encompass the provision of Taurus missiles to Ukraine and the use of frozen Russian assets in the EU to fund Ukrainian defense.
